Get ready to dive into a world of thrills at TLCWin Casino! This fantastic online casino is specifically designed for Australian players, offering a huge selection of games and phenomenal bonuses. Whether spinning the http://tlcwin.top
The Ultimate TLCWin Casino: A Gaming Paradise
Internet 7 hours ago prestonptyd231170Web Directory Categories
Web Directory Search
New Site Listings